Transaction 8bda30284fc1cc27a19b40400e9f672ad33d6d68f17e8b383edc6ac5cc5e7642

block
1bc4cdd3adf79b093fd54914f302d20d8a488b3e45026ae6b95dc730d83796d9

1 Input

37 Outputs